当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器内存多少合适,服务器内存配置指南,不同场景下的内存需求分析及优化建议

服务器内存多少合适,服务器内存配置指南,不同场景下的内存需求分析及优化建议

服务器内存配置需根据应用场景和需求进行。一般而言,小型服务器可配置4-8GB内存,中型服务器8-16GB,大型服务器16GB以上。针对不同应用,如数据库、虚拟化等,需额...

服务器内存配置需根据应用场景和需求进行。一般而言,小型服务器可配置4-8GB内存,中型服务器8-16GB,大型服务器16GB以上。针对不同应用,如数据库、虚拟化等,需额外考虑内存需求。优化建议包括合理分配内存、定期清理缓存、优化数据库查询等。

随着互联网技术的飞速发展,服务器已经成为企业信息化建设的重要基石,而服务器内存作为其核心组成部分,直接关系到服务器性能和稳定性,服务器内存一般多大合适呢?本文将从不同场景出发,分析服务器内存需求,并提供相应的优化建议。

服务器内存需求分析

1、服务器类型

服务器内存多少合适,服务器内存配置指南,不同场景下的内存需求分析及优化建议

(1)Web服务器:主要用于处理网页浏览、文件下载等操作,一般内存需求在4GB-16GB之间,根据服务器负载和并发访问量进行调整。

(2)数据库服务器:如MySQL、Oracle等,内存需求较高,根据数据库类型和规模,内存需求一般在16GB-64GB之间。

(3)文件服务器:主要用于文件存储和共享,内存需求相对较低,一般在4GB-16GB之间。

(4)虚拟化服务器:如VMware、Xen等,内存需求取决于虚拟机数量和配置,一般每个虚拟机内存需求在2GB-8GB之间,总内存需求在64GB-512GB之间。

(5)应用服务器:如Java、.NET等,内存需求取决于应用类型和规模,一般内存需求在16GB-64GB之间。

2、服务器负载和并发访问量

服务器负载和并发访问量是影响内存需求的重要因素,负载和并发访问量越高,内存需求越大,以下是一些常见场景下的内存需求参考:

(1)低负载:4GB-8GB

(2)中等负载:8GB-16GB

(3)高负载:16GB-32GB

(4)极高负载:32GB以上

3、系统和应用程序需求

服务器内存多少合适,服务器内存配置指南,不同场景下的内存需求分析及优化建议

不同操作系统和应用程序对内存的需求不同,以下是一些常见系统和应用程序的内存需求:

(1)Windows Server:4GB-32GB

(2)Linux:2GB-16GB

(3)MySQL:16GB-64GB

(4)Oracle:16GB-128GB

(5)Java:16GB-64GB

(6).NET:16GB-64GB

服务器内存优化建议

1、根据需求选择合适的内存容量

在购买服务器时,应根据实际需求选择合适的内存容量,避免过度配置,造成资源浪费;也不要配置过低,导致服务器性能下降。

2、采用内存条规格统一

尽量使用相同规格的内存条,以减少兼容性问题,若需升级内存,建议购买相同品牌和型号的内存条。

3、合理分配内存资源

服务器内存多少合适,服务器内存配置指南,不同场景下的内存需求分析及优化建议

对于多任务处理的服务器,合理分配内存资源至关重要,可以通过操作系统设置或应用程序配置,调整内存分配策略。

4、定期清理内存

定期清理内存可以释放不必要的内存占用,提高服务器性能,可以使用操作系统自带的内存清理工具,如Windows的“任务管理器”和Linux的“free”命令。

5、监控内存使用情况

实时监控内存使用情况,及时发现异常并解决问题,可以使用操作系统自带的监控工具,如Windows的“性能监视器”和Linux的“top”命令。

6、预留一定内存空间

为防止内存不足导致服务器崩溃,建议预留一定内存空间,一般预留20%-30%的内存空间为宜。

7、使用虚拟内存

当服务器内存不足时,可以使用虚拟内存来缓解内存压力,但要注意,虚拟内存会降低服务器性能,因此建议合理配置。

服务器内存配置应根据实际需求、服务器类型、操作系统、应用程序等因素综合考虑,通过合理配置和优化,可以有效提高服务器性能和稳定性,在实际应用中,还需不断调整和优化内存配置,以满足不断变化的需求。

黑狐家游戏

发表评论

最新文章